WebJul 19, 2024 · In this sentence duolingo has used は (though you could also use が), which makes English the subject of the sentence. What the speaker wants to know is if you can speak English, regardless of whatever other languages you speak. You can use を with the potential form, but it changes the nuance. WebJan 5, 2015 · 1 Answer. There really isn't much difference in meaning between "speak English" and "speak in English" from a practical point of view. However, the two phrases use a slightly different meaning of the verb "to speak". In the first the meaning is "be able to communicate in a language" such as "he speaks English fluently", in the second you are ...
